Brockport, NY – On Tuesday, November 8
th the SUNY Brockport men's basketball team will host Alfred University for the start of the 2022-23 season. The year gets started at 6:30pm in the Jim and John Vlogianitis Gymnasium.
Recap of Last Season: Brockport's 2021-22 season came to an end after a 64-54 loss to Oneonta in the SUNYAC Semifinals. The team finished with an 18-8 record overall and a 12-6 record against conference opponents. At home Brockport took care of business with a 9-2 mark at The Vlog. The Golden Eagles concluded the regular season as the No. 3 seed for the SUNYAC Tournament. They hosted No. 6 Potsdam for the opening round, winning 62-55, before eventually falling to Oneonta in the semis.
Getting it Dunne: Heading into his 16
th season at Brockport, Head Coach
Greg Dunne returns to lead the program once again. Last year Dunne led the team to its eighth consecutive appearance in the SUNYAC Semifinals. Since taking over the program for the start of the 2007-08 season he has pushed the Golden Eagles into the conference tournament each year. Greg has brought three SUNYAC Titles back to Brockport and led the team into the NCAA Tournament four times.
All-Conference Returner: After earning 1
st-Team All-Conference two straight seasons,
Jahidi Wallace returns for another go around. He led the team in scoring with 15.4 points a game last year on 49.8% from the field, 40.6% from long range, and 74.7% at the foul line. Wallace is also approaching an all-time milestone at Brockport. With 983 career points he needs just 17 more in order to become the 25
th member of the program's 1,000 Point Club.
SUNYAC Rookie of the Year: Returning for his sophomore season is last year's SUNYAC Rookie of the Year,
Mekhi Beckett. In his first year he was the second leading scorer for the Golden Eagles, averaging 14.1 points per game. Beckett was the top threat from beyond the 3-point arc for the Green and Gold with 45 made 3-pointers on 39.1% shooting from deep. Mekhi was selected for 2
nd-Team All-Conference following his freshman campaign.

Schedule Summary: The Golden Eagles will begin the schedule with three consecutive home games against Alfred, Keystone, and Hobart. Following a road matchup with York before Thanksgiving Break, they get SUNYAC play started. Most of the early December games are on the road before Brockport heads to DME Academy in Daytona Beach, FL for the annual Mauro Panaggio Tournament on December 18
th and 19
th. Returning from the winter break the team gets back into the thick of conference play. It all boils down to a pair of home SUNYAC matchups with Oswego and Buffalo State on February 17
th and 18
th for the regular season finale. The postseason begins on Tuesday, February 21
st for the opening round of the SUNYAC Tournament.
